Orienteering race (White Rose day2) 53:41 [5] 5.3 km (10:08 / km) +125m 9:04 / km
shoes: inov8 oroc 280

Didn't run as well today. Set off very well, got the first 9 spot on really then slowed on number 10 for some reason. During the course of 11-13 we must have climbed about 250-300feet up the escarpment which was a killer. So i was too high on 12 and lost maybe a minute or so and then made a stupid mistake once i got back on the flat area on top by taking the wrong path down to number 13. The rest of the race was dotted with mistakes through carelessness or bad route choice on (15,17,23,24) they weren't massive mistakes but every one adds up so i lost way too much time. Also after i got past about 18-19 i began to feel really massively fatigued, maybe i over did it yesterday seeing as i'm technically still recovering. But felt pretty bad at the end, was really tired throught the last 1.5-2km so again, endurance work is needed. Was relatively pleased with the race given that i'm still working my way back in but would have prefered to be sub 49/48.30.

Orienteering race (White Rose day1) 57:13 [5] 6.1 km (9:23 / km) +145m 8:23 / km
shoes: inov8 oroc 280

First proper race where i was actually racing since injury and i felt really good. Spiked the first 7 controls which is unusual for me but made perhaps a 3 and a half minute mistake on number 8. After that the race was steady with very few mistakes except on number 20 where i completely missed a path. Began to feel very tired in my legs during the last 2km or so, so am needing to work on some endurance before the next few races this year. But finished 1st today so that was a good starting point for the rest of the weekend.
